Modifikátor a typ | Trieda a opis |
---|---|
class |
Castica
Alias pre
Častica . |
class |
Častica
Toto je pomocná trieda určená na tvorbu časticových simulácií.
|
class |
GRobot
Ústredná trieda definujúca všetky metódy grafického robota (ktoré reprezentujú jeho funkcionalitu) a viaceré konštanty, ktoré sú pri práci s programovacím rámcom s výhodou využiteľné.
|
class |
Uhol
Táto trieda uchováva hodnotu uhla použiteľnú na rôznych miestach
programovacieho rámca.
|
Modifikátor a typ | Metóda a opis |
---|---|
static Uhol |
Uhol.dialogVolbaSmeru(Smer počiatočnýSmer)
Alias pre
zvoľSmer . |
static Uhol |
Uhol.dialógVoľbaSmeru(Smer počiatočnýSmer)
Alias pre
zvoľSmer . |
static Uhol |
Uhol.dialogVolbaSmeru(String titulok,
Smer počiatočnýSmer)
Alias pre
zvoľSmer . |
static Uhol |
Uhol.dialógVoľbaSmeru(String titulok,
Smer počiatočnýSmer)
Alias pre
zvoľSmer . |
static Uhol |
Uhol.dialogVyberSmeru(Smer počiatočnýSmer)
Alias pre
vyberSmer . |
static Uhol |
Uhol.dialógVýberSmeru(Smer počiatočnýSmer)
Alias pre
vyberSmer . |
static Uhol |
Uhol.dialogVyberSmeru(String titulok,
Smer počiatočnýSmer)
Alias pre
vyberSmer . |
static Uhol |
Uhol.dialógVýberSmeru(String titulok,
Smer počiatočnýSmer)
Alias pre
vyberSmer . |
void |
GRobot.domov(double novéXDoma,
double novéYDoma,
Smer novýSmerDoma)
Presne ako
domov , len s tým rozdielom, že
robotu nastaví novú štartovaciu pozíciu a smer. |
void |
GRobot.domov(Poloha nováPolohaDoma,
Smer novýSmerDoma)
Presne ako
domov , len s tým rozdielom, že
robotu nastaví novú štartovaciu pozíciu a smer. |
void |
GRobot.domov(Smer novýSmerDoma)
Presne ako
domov , len s tým rozdielom, že
robotu nastaví nový štartovací smer. |
void |
GRobot.chodNaPootoceny(double x,
double y,
Smer smer)
Alias pre
choďNaPootočený . |
void |
GRobot.chodNaPootoceny(Poloha poloha,
Smer smer)
Alias pre
choďNaPootočený . |
void |
GRobot.choďNaPootočený(double x,
double y,
Smer smer)
Tento príkaz pošle robot na miesto určené pootočením
zadaných súradníc o zadaný uhol so stredom otáčania
v mieste robota.
|
void |
GRobot.choďNaPootočený(Poloha poloha,
Smer smer)
Tento príkaz pošle robot na miesto určené pootočením
zadaných súradníc o zadaný uhol so stredom otáčania
v mieste robota.
|
void |
GRobot.chodPootoceny(double Δx,
double Δy,
Smer smer)
Alias pre
choďPootočený . |
void |
GRobot.choďPootočený(double Δx,
double Δy,
Smer smer)
Tento príkaz pošle robot na miesto určené pootočením
zadaných relatívnych súradníc o zadaný uhol.
|
void |
GRobot.novyDomov(double novéXDoma,
double novéYDoma,
Smer novýSmerDoma)
Alias pre
novýDomov . |
void |
GRobot.novýDomov(double novéXDoma,
double novéYDoma,
Smer novýSmerDoma)
Nastaví robotu novú domovskú pozíciu a smer.
|
void |
GRobot.novyDomov(Poloha nováPolohaDoma,
Smer novýSmerDoma)
Alias pre
novýDomov . |
void |
GRobot.novýDomov(Poloha nováPolohaDoma,
Smer novýSmerDoma)
Nastaví robotu novú domovskú pozíciu a smer.
|
void |
GRobot.novyDomov(Smer novýSmerDoma)
Alias pre
novýDomov . |
void |
GRobot.novýDomov(Smer novýSmerDoma)
Nastaví robotu nový domovský smer.
|
void |
GRobot.otoc(Smer objekt)
Alias pre
otoč . |
void |
GRobot.otoc(Smer objekt,
double najviacO)
Alias pre
otoč . |
static void |
Svet.otocenieVyplne(Smer smer)
Alias pre
otočenieVýplne . |
static void |
Svet.otocenieVyplne(Smer smer,
double sx,
double sy)
Alias pre
otočenieVýplne . |
static void |
Svet.otocenieVyplne(Smer smer,
Poloha poloha)
Alias pre
otočenieVýplne . |
static void |
Svet.otocenieVyplne(Smer smer,
Shape tvar)
Alias pre
otočenieVýplne . |
void |
GRobot.otoč(Smer objekt)
Nasmeruje tento robot rovnakým smerom, akým je otočený
zadaný objekt.
|
void |
GRobot.otoč(Smer objekt,
double najviacO)
Funguje podobne ako metóda
otoč ,
ibaže obmedzuje uhol pootočenia stanoveným smerom – neotočí
robot okamžite podľa smeru iného robota, iba ním pootočí
o maximálnu zadanú hodnotu uhla. |
static void |
Svet.otočenieVýplne(Smer smer)
Táto metóda funguje podobne ako metóda
otočenieVýplne(uhol) . |
static void |
Svet.otočenieVýplne(Smer smer,
double sx,
double sy)
Táto metóda funguje podobne ako metóda
otočenieVýplne(uhol, sx, sy) . |
static void |
Svet.otočenieVýplne(Smer smer,
Poloha poloha)
Táto metóda funguje podobne ako metóda
otočenieVýplne(uhol, sx, sy) . |
static void |
Svet.otočenieVýplne(Smer smer,
Shape tvar)
Táto metóda funguje podobne ako metóda
otočenieVýplne(uhol, sx, sy) . |
static void |
Svet.pootocenieVyplne(Smer smer)
Alias pre
pootočenieVýplne . |
static void |
Svet.pootocenieVyplne(Smer smer,
double sx,
double sy)
Alias pre
pootočenieVýplne . |
static void |
Svet.pootocenieVyplne(Smer smer,
Poloha poloha)
Alias pre
pootočenieVýplne . |
static void |
Svet.pootocenieVyplne(Smer smer,
Shape tvar)
Alias pre
pootočenieVýplne . |
static void |
Svet.pootočenieVýplne(Smer smer)
Táto metóda funguje podobne ako metóda
pootočenieVýplne(uhol) . |
static void |
Svet.pootočenieVýplne(Smer smer,
double sx,
double sy)
Táto metóda funguje podobne ako metóda
pootočenieVýplne(uhol, sx, sy) . |
static void |
Svet.pootočenieVýplne(Smer smer,
Poloha poloha)
Táto metóda funguje podobne ako metóda
pootočenieVýplne(uhol, sx, sy) . |
static void |
Svet.pootočenieVýplne(Smer smer,
Shape tvar)
Táto metóda funguje podobne ako metóda
pootočenieVýplne(uhol, sx, sy) . |
void |
GRobot.posunVSmere(Smer smer)
Alias pre
posuňVSmere . |
void |
GRobot.posuňVSmere(Smer smer)
Prikáže robotu, aby sa posunul v zadanom smere
o hodnotu svojej veľkosti.
|
void |
GRobot.posunVSmere(Smer smer,
double dĺžka)
Alias pre
posuňVSmere . |
void |
Bod.posunVSmere(Smer smer,
double dĺžka)
Alias pre
posuňVSmere . |
void |
GRobot.posuňVSmere(Smer smer,
double dĺžka)
Prikáže robotu, aby sa posunul v zadanom smere
o zadanú dĺžku.
|
void |
Bod.posuňVSmere(Smer smer,
double dĺžka)
Posunie súradnice tohto bodu určeným smerom o zadanú vzdialenosť.
|
void |
GRobot.preskocVSmere(Smer smer)
Alias pre
preskočVSmere . |
void |
GRobot.preskocVSmere(Smer smer,
double dĺžka)
Alias pre
preskočVSmere . |
void |
GRobot.preskočVSmere(Smer smer)
Prikáže robotu, aby preskočil v zadanom smere o hodnotu
svojej veľkosti.
|
void |
GRobot.preskočVSmere(Smer smer,
double dĺžka)
Prikáže robotu, aby preskočil v zadanom smere
o zadanú dĺžku.
|
void |
GRobot.skocNaPootoceny(double x,
double y,
Smer smer)
Alias pre
skočNaPootočený . |
void |
GRobot.skocNaPootoceny(Poloha poloha,
Smer smer)
Alias pre
skočNaPootočený . |
void |
GRobot.skocPootoceny(double Δx,
double Δy,
Smer smer)
Alias pre
skočPootočený . |
void |
GRobot.skočNaPootočený(double x,
double y,
Smer smer)
Tento príkaz pošle robot na miesto určené pootočením
zadaných súradníc o zadaný uhol so stredom otáčania
v mieste robota.
|
void |
GRobot.skočNaPootočený(Poloha poloha,
Smer smer)
Tento príkaz pošle robot na miesto určené pootočením
zadaných súradníc o zadaný uhol so stredom otáčania
v mieste robota.
|
void |
GRobot.skočPootočený(double Δx,
double Δy,
Smer smer)
Tento príkaz pošle robot na miesto určené pootočením
zadaných relatívnych súradníc o zadaný uhol.
|
void |
Častica.smer(Smer objekt)
|
void |
GRobot.smer(Smer objekt)
|
void |
Častica.uhol(Smer objekt)
|
void |
GRobot.uhol(Smer objekt)
|
static Uhol |
Uhol.vyberSmer(Smer počiatočnýSmer)
Otvorí dialóg na výber smeru.
|
static Uhol |
Uhol.vyberSmer(String titulok,
Smer počiatočnýSmer)
Otvorí dialóg na výber smeru.
|
static Uhol |
Uhol.zvolSmer(Smer počiatočnýSmer)
Alias pre
zvoľSmer . |
static Uhol |
Uhol.zvoľSmer(Smer počiatočnýSmer)
Otvorí dialóg na výber smeru.
|
static Uhol |
Uhol.zvolSmer(String titulok,
Smer počiatočnýSmer)
Alias pre
zvoľSmer . |
static Uhol |
Uhol.zvoľSmer(String titulok,
Smer počiatočnýSmer)
Otvorí dialóg na výber smeru.
|